Job Summary:
Join the Align-Pilates team as a Pilates/Fitness Equipment Installer and play a key role in delivering, installing, and servicing Pilates equipment for private gyms, studios and commercial premises across the UK.
We are seeking an individual with the ability to handle heavy items, experience with hand tools, an eye or ability to build or repairing products, strong teamwork skills, and a valid driving license with a minimum of 2 years.
Key Responsibilities:
- Safely transport and install Pilates equipment in various locations, including private gyms and commercial premises.
- Navigate challenges such as installations above or below ground floor level, requiring the lifting and carrying of heavy items.
- Carry out servicing of Pilates equipment to ensure optimal performance.
- Utilise hand tools to address any repairs or issues with products, demonstrating an aptitude for building and troubleshooting.
- Work effectively as part of a team to coordinate installations, deliveries, and servicing tasks.
- Collaborate with colleagues to ensure efficient workflow and timely completion of projects.
Driving Responsibilities:
- Hold a valid driving license and have a minimum of 2 years of driving experience for insurance purposes.
- Responsibly operate a company vehicle to transport equipment to designated locations.
Communication Skills:
- Possess good verbal communication skills to interact with customers and team members effectively.
- Provide reliable updates on projects and report any issues promptly.
Requirements:
- Physical ability to lift and carry heavy items, as installations may involve navigating various levels.
- Experience in using hand tools and a demonstrated aptitude for building or repairing products (training provided).
- Team player with the ability to collaborate and work efficiently with others.
- Hold a valid driving license with a minimum of 2 years driving experience for insurance purposes.
- Strong verbal communication skills and a reliable work ethic.
Job Types:
Full-time, Permanent
Pay:
£23,000.00-£26,000.00 per year
Benefits:
- Onsite parking
Schedule:
- Monday to Friday
- No weekends
Supplemental pay types:
- Bonus scheme
Work Location:
In person
